I have a used jeep key i purchased on ebay for my 2013 jeep wrangler i replaced the key part and had it cut can it be wiped clean and reprogramed to work on my jeep?
This is a used key I purchased on ebay and I was told it needs to be reset before I can program it. Anyone know how to reset it or wipe it clean if possible?
It takes two good keys to program the third. If you don't have two recognized keys - you're going to the dealer.
You can get a new cheapo key (no buttons) off ebay for about $7. I hope you got a good deal on the used one. If it cut fine, the manual has directions - easy to program yourself. Sometimes you might need to do it a second time, but it always works - I've done a dozen or more.
